Zappaman:

Buy the Friday issue of Clarin. It includes a young people section called "Sí" (Yes), which advertises all the weekly music events (for any ages).

Usually, there is a column or two devoted to Jazz and Blues. During the mid 90s, the Blues was hot in BA and many players came to BA (Taj Mahal, BB King, Buddy Guy, Miles Davis, etc). I was pretty glad to attend those concerts.

As for usual pubs that play live blues music, I remember the following ones:

- Oliverio (Parana St between Corrientes Av and Sarmiento St) plays alternative and fussion. It is located in the same block as the Centro Cultural General San Martin, which organizes a Jazz cycle called "Jazzologia" once a week. This cycle is ridiculously cheap (ar$5 or 10 the entrance, if not free at all) and of high quality.

- Cafe Tortoni (Av de Mayo in the 800s) plays traditional Jazz in one of the oldest cafes of Buenos Aires. A must go.

- El Samovar de Rasputin (Almirante Brown Av and Pi i Margall St). Nice place, although sketchy since it is located in La Boca, near Parque Lezama.
